TREE NEWS reports: Natural gas speculators across the four NYMEX and ICE markets increased their net short positions by 3,719 lots to 54,416 lots in the week ended September 8, the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ission said. The data covers the NYMEX and ICE natural gas contracts tracked in the CFTC’s weekly positioning report.
